Acoustic resonance spectra of a finite cylindrical shell [PDF]
Previous studies have explained acoustic scattering from an infinite cylinder or a sphere. The scattering depends strongly on resonances that are related to the propagation of circumferential waves when the acoustic axis is perpendicular to the cylinder axis or the propagation of guided waves when the insonification is oblique.

Hawking radiation in dispersive media [PDF]
Hawking radiation, despite its presence in theoretical physics for over thirty years, remains elusive and undetected. It also suffers, in its original context of gravitational black holes, from conceptual difficulties.

Spectra of Interacting Acoustical Waves with a Turbulent Wake [PDF]
The state of a compressible fluid is completely prescribed by its velocity, density, pressure, and temperature fields. When the compressible fluid is in a turbulent flow, all these quantities fluctuate in a random manner. Flexible Dielectric Acoustic Resonator Patch for Tissue Regeneration
A flexible dielectric acoustic resonator patch enables MHz‐range ultrasound generation through resonance amplification without using piezoelectric materials. Conformal integration on a curved substrate allows efficient acoustic delivery to tissue‐mimicking environments.
